Narvacan, officially the Municipality of Narvacan (; ), is a municipality in the province of Ilocos Sur, Philippines. According to the , it has a population of people.
==History== A Spanish expeditionary force sent from Vigan by the military officer and navigator, Captain Juan de Salcedo was shipwrecked along the town's coast in 1576. When they were being rescued by the natives, the Spaniards asked the natives what the name of their place was. The resident's leader replied in an Ilocano dialect by asking the Spaniards, "Nalbakan?" (Are you shipwrecked?). The Spaniards thought this to be the answer to their question, and from then, the place was referred to as Narvacan.
